Код программы: pastebin.com/e0R5MjrD Работа с MFU: • Minecraft: OpenCompute... Предыдущая программа: • OpenComputers. Програм... Группа: club175856943
Пікірлер: 55
@reactor_play98992 жыл бұрын
OC круто давай больше!
@mrWhiskasss2 жыл бұрын
подписался в 2017 году ради OC и Даааа урааааа
@Hikooshi2 жыл бұрын
вообще там не так давно программа выложена еще
@logic45192 жыл бұрын
блиин заждался видео, только умоляю хоть по чуть чуть тренеруйся и совершенствуйся, вспоминая твой код слезы сами наварачиваються представляя твой пот во время кодинга
@Hikooshi2 жыл бұрын
я все равно не понимаю, что тебе не нравится в моем коде, если критикуешь, то приводи примеры
@logic45192 жыл бұрын
@@Hikooshi скотрел на твой код с пк отступы неправильные не такие как должы быть по стандарту lua, все както навалено бееее
@Hikooshi2 жыл бұрын
@@logic4519 перфекционист? сочувствую. Мне приходилось читать код вообще без отступов и все понятно было. Это не Питон, здесь отступы нужны только для красоты и если это единственная твоя претензия, то, думаю, стоит прекратить дискуссию
@logic45192 жыл бұрын
@@Hikooshi ок
@Hikooshi2 жыл бұрын
@@logic4519 ладно, может я грубо сказал, извини, если так. Еще хотел добавить, что кодю я в самой игре и без подсветки синтаксиса мне просто пришлось выработать свои принципы написания, чтоб точно найти, где, например, начинается и заканчивается функция. Вот на этом точно про отступы завершаем
@logic45192 жыл бұрын
оказываеться можно сделать пробуждения по redstone (rs.setWakeThreshold(сторона)) работает даже на красном контрольлере, ошибочька вышла там не сторона а какаето вигня а реагирует со всех сторон поэксперементируйте
@Hikooshi2 жыл бұрын
возможно, если так, то молодец, что сам нашел
@logic45192 жыл бұрын
@@Hikooshi не сам, подскозали тогда когда я это искал незнал о программе components в openOS а когда узнал уже думал что невозможно(вы сказали) и недопер сам проверить api
@user-rd7kd9on6m2 жыл бұрын
здравствуйте, можно программу для фермы визеров?
@Hikooshi2 жыл бұрын
можно, но опиши, как ты представляешь систему целиком? я для себя писал, но там Industrial Foregoing мод применяется
@logic45192 жыл бұрын
как сделать чтобы openOS работала на нескольких экранах
@Hikooshi2 жыл бұрын
сделать можно, но придется дополнительный код писать, вроде делал через event.invoke()
@logic45192 жыл бұрын
@@Hikooshi event? может component? я вообще про такой метод не знал что у event есть какойта invoke
@logic45192 жыл бұрын
@@Hikooshi модет есть ос совместимая с openOS но с поддержкой нескольких мониторов?
@logic45192 жыл бұрын
@@Hikooshi я мону попробовать из под bios создать виртуальную видеокарту и виртуальный экран и поставить их выше приаритетом, но это уже лютые кастыли
@Hikooshi2 жыл бұрын
@@logic4519 да, компонент, не ивент
@logic45192 жыл бұрын
будут еше видео?
@Hikooshi2 жыл бұрын
видео будут, но щас со временем не все просто
@logic45192 жыл бұрын
@@Hikooshi рвбота? учеба?
@4eyto_mal4ik722 жыл бұрын
Здравствуйте
@Hikooshi2 жыл бұрын
здравствуй
@logic45192 жыл бұрын
ну так что поповоду нормальных отступов в коде? уде 13дней ответа жду
@Hikooshi2 жыл бұрын
я не сразу понял, что хотел от меня. Вообще там есть отступы
@logic45192 жыл бұрын
@Hikooshi есть отступы не значит, красивый код, необходимо ставить отступы везде побольше функций меньше повторений мой код за 3 месяца улутшился больше чем твой за 6 лет, это обьяснимо моим яным возрастом но всеже задумайсы над оптимизацией(gui должно быть отдельной библиотекой итд) дая совет заведи себе диблиотеку типо extraUtils (это уже занято челом из твоего паблика) или нечьто подобное и добовляй туда часто используемы функции, кста переменной с именем _ всеровно присваеться значения и все нечего но если передать функции _ как бы имея ввиду nil чего хорошего не жди, так что на вход функциям нада писать nil
@Hikooshi2 жыл бұрын
@@logic4519 очень сложно читать твой текст, так же, если ты думаешь, что я кодю каждый день, то сильно ошибаешься. Оптимизация? что конкретно тебе не понравилось (я знаю, что есть повторение кода и если буду дорабатывать программу, то это будет исправлено. Так как у людей не особо много интереса, то пока этого делать не хочется)
@logic45192 жыл бұрын
@@Hikooshi основная проблемма в том что у вас код почьти не прогрессирует даже за прошедшие 6 лет как видел неправельные отступы так и продолжаю их видеть
@Hikooshi2 жыл бұрын
@@logic4519 ну, во-первых, 6 лет назад отступы я вообще не делал и переменные в локальные не выделял, так же много if'ов было. А во-вторых, что значит неправильные отступы? Какие для тебя правильными будут? Ах да, если открывать код в сторонних редакторах отступов и правда может не быть. Так же, насчет того, что нужно писать библиотеки и все такое: писать код интерфейса в основном коде тоже правильно, потому что в этом случае человеку не придется скачивать библиотеку отдельно. Возможно, если б у меня была своя операционка или даже просто библиотека приложений, привязанная к гитхабу, то да, так бы они сами скачивались бы, но у меня самостоятельные программы. И еще, когда пишешь так, то человек может точно проследить, что и как работает. Например, когда я еще только учился, то пытался читать код ECG или как-то так, у него своя операционка и все завязано на библиотеки. Для единственной программы мне просто не захотелось дальше его код из-за этого изучать. В то же время Totoro и Neo написали редактор голограмм, в нем интерфейс был написан в основном коде, потому для себя я понял многие основные элементы языка
@user-lo1kr1hv9t2 жыл бұрын
обнови видео по lua с того времени язык изменился и по тем видео невозможно написать код версия Lua 5.2 а на твоих видео 1.5 или 1.7
@Hikooshi2 жыл бұрын
на моих видео версия 5.1
@logic45192 жыл бұрын
эти версии ламо того что не публичьные, они блин старше меня будут даже до 2000 год вышли
@logic45192 жыл бұрын
хватить писать "плоско", так и тебе дебажить легче будет и нам читать приятнее)